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Off Topic
    4. Liste der Homematic Geräte erstellen

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Liste der Homematic Geräte erstellen

    This topic has been deleted. Only users with topic management privileges can see it.
    • Homoran
      Homoran Global Moderator Administrators @paul53 last edited by

      @paul53 sagte in Liste der Homematic Geräte erstellen:

      @Homoran
      8 Geräte, die kein "0.UNREACH" haben ?

      keine Ahnung.
      2 habe ich inzwischen gefunden, auf der Testinstanz hatte ich wired nicht aktiv, die letzten 6 könnten CuxD Geräte sein, weiß aber im Moment nicht ob das so viele waren.

      EDIT: laut CuxD gibt es 5 Geräte

      paul53 1 Reply Last reply Reply Quote 0
      • paul53
        paul53 @Homoran last edited by

        @Homoran sagte:

        laut CuxD gibt es 5 Geräte

        Dann fehlt ja nur noch ein Gerät 😀

        Homoran 1 Reply Last reply Reply Quote 0
        • Homoran
          Homoran Global Moderator Administrators @paul53 last edited by

          @paul53 sagte in Liste der Homematic Geräte erstellen:

          @Homoran sagte:

          laut CuxD gibt es 5 Geräte

          Dann fehlt ja nur noch ein Gerät 😀

          Genau - das Risiko nehme ich in Kauf 😉

          Gefunden!!!
          die virtuellen Kanäe BidCos_RF!

          Super!

          1 Reply Last reply Reply Quote 0
          • Homoran
            Homoran Global Moderator Administrators last edited by

            Jetzt geht es noch um das Sahnehäubchen
            (und die Kirsche darauf): kann man auch den Raum auslesen?

            Wichtiger ist jedoch wie ich es "maschinenlesbar" hinbekomme
            HM_Liste_V02b.png

            Ich bekomme keinen Zeilenumbruch hin um es in Open office zeilenweise einlesen zu können

            paul53 1 Reply Last reply Reply Quote 0
            • paul53
              paul53 @Homoran last edited by paul53

              @Homoran sagte:

              Ich bekomme keinen Zeilenumbruch hin

              Blockly_temp.JPG

              Homoran 1 Reply Last reply Reply Quote 0
              • Homoran
                Homoran Global Moderator Administrators @paul53 last edited by

                @paul53 <br> habe ich auch schon gemacht, wird aber nicht als Zeilenumbruch erkannt 😞
                Habe es dann im Notepad++ eingelesen und manuell nach <br>, gesucht und ENTER gedrückt

                127x f3 - ENTER und fertig 😉

                paul53 1 Reply Last reply Reply Quote 0
                • paul53
                  paul53 @Homoran last edited by

                  @Homoran sagte:

                  wird aber nicht als Zeilenumbruch erkannt

                  Bei mir macht die Log-Ausgabe die Zeilenumbrüche. Wenn ich die Log-Ausgabe in Notepad++ einfüge und anschließend als CSV-Datei abspeichere, kann ich es sofort als Tabelle einlesen.

                  Homoran 1 Reply Last reply Reply Quote 0
                  • Homoran
                    Homoran Global Moderator Administrators @paul53 last edited by

                    @paul53 gut ich hatte <br> als Textblock
                    dann teste ich mal mit dem "Liste mit Trennzeichen"-Block

                    paul53 1 Reply Last reply Reply Quote 0
                    • paul53
                      paul53 @Homoran last edited by

                      @Homoran
                      Korrektur: In JS Version 3.6.4 funktioniert es mit <br>, in neueren Versionen nicht.

                      Homoran 1 Reply Last reply Reply Quote 0
                      • Homoran
                        Homoran Global Moderator Administrators @paul53 last edited by Homoran

                        @paul53 sagte in Liste der Homematic Geräte erstellen:

                        in neueren Versionen nicht.

                        😢
                        HM_Liste_V02c_ohne_Umbruch.png

                        Bestätigt!
                        Habe wegen einer anderen Funktion 4.6.23 drauf


                        HM_Liste_Tabelle.png

                        Welche Informationen dafür liefert denn die Funktion noch?
                        ggf. an 1., 7. oder wieveilter auch immer Position?

                        paul53 1 Reply Last reply Reply Quote 0
                        • paul53
                          paul53 @Homoran last edited by

                          @Homoran sagte:

                          Welche Informationen dafür liefert denn die Funktion noch?
                          ggf. an 1., 7. oder wieveilter auch immer Position?

                          Was meinst Du ?

                          Homoran 1 Reply Last reply Reply Quote 0
                          • Homoran
                            Homoran Global Moderator Administrators @paul53 last edited by Homoran

                            @paul53 sagte in Liste der Homematic Geräte erstellen:

                            Was meinst Du ?

                            ich hatte gehofft, dass ich einfach weitere Elemente aus den Datenpunkten hinzufügen kann, indem ich nicht das 3. Element aus der Funktion (=common name) sondern ein x-tes Element = HM-LC-Sw1_PBU nehmen könnte.

                            Habe einige schon ausprobiert aber nichts gefunden.

                            statt dessen hat es mir gerade die Ausgabe umformatiert 😉

                            ['GEQ0013764,Schluessel_Papa<CR>','HEQ0105937,Windsensor<CR>','IEQ0086197,schlüssel_Mona<CR>','JEQ0031354,JEQ0031354<CR>','JEQ0033065,Licht_SZ<CR>','JEQ0046663,Klima_Werkstatt<CR>','JEQ0047574,Leinwand<CR>','JEQ0064523,Klima_Bad<CR>','JEQ0090871,Wandtaster_Ladestrom<CR>','JEQ0090876,Funktaster 3<CR>','JEQ0092921,Licht_SZ<CR>','JEQ0093682,Licht_Balkon<CR>','JEQ0093694,Licht_Treppe_DG<CR>','JEQ0096204,Licht_Gast<CR>','JEQ0101940,Licht_Arcade<CR>','JEQ0110516,Rolladen Mona<CR>','JEQ0112228,Rolladen Schlafzimmer<CR>','JEQ0112436,Rolladen_Stubentuer<CR>','JEQ0112542,Rolladen Tina<CR>','JEQ0112564,Rolladen Stubenfenster<CR>','JEQ0112571,Markise<CR>','JEQ0114266,Rolladen_Kueche<CR>','JEQ0139530,Unterschrankbeleuchtung<CR>','JEQ0140901,Wetterstation<CR>','JEQ0201654,Licht_Stube_Kranz<CR>','JEQ0202324,Licht_Stube_Decke<CR>','JEQ0202330,Licht_Esszimmer<CR>','JEQ0243266,Taster Esszimmer<CR>','JEQ0267518,Klima_Saunakabine<CR>','JEQ0459186,BWM_hinten<CR>','JEQ0459314,BWM_vorne<CR>','JEQ0459323,BWM_Garten<CR>','JEQ0466320,Schloss_Haustuer<CR>','JEQ0466609,Schlüssel Mama<CR>','JEQ0499736,Steckerschalter Garage<CR>','JEQ0646431,quattro<CR>','JRT0001400,Griff WC<CR>','JRT0001416,Griff Schlafzimmer<CR>','JRT0001572,Griff Bad<CR>','JRT0001587,Griff Kellertür<CR>','KEQ0035101,Luefter_Dusche<CR>','KEQ0068246,Griff Stubentür<CR>','KEQ0120652,3_fach_01<CR>','KEQ0120726,3-Fach-Taster_Stube<CR>','KEQ0543528,Heizkreis<CR>','KEQ0543553,HKV_OG<CR>','KEQ0543560,Therme<CR>','KEQ0713122,Rauchmelder_Studio<CR>','KEQ0713193,Rauchmelder_Heizung<CR>','KEQ0848001,Griff_Arcade<CR>','KEQ0963067,Hitzesensor_vorne<CR>','KEQ0963583,Hitzesensor_hinten<CR>','KEQ0966548,Strom_Spuelmaschine<CR>','KEQ0967747,Waschmaschine<CR>','KEQ1022589,Regensensor<CR>','KEQ1070107,BWM KEQ1070107<CR>','LEQ0073262,Gong_EG<CR>','LEQ0080851,Klima_SZ<CR>','LEQ0081020,Klima_Stube<CR>','LEQ0143433,Griff_Studio_rechts<CR>','LEQ0242145,Steckdose_Stube_hinten_rechts<CR>','LEQ0242152,Steckdose_Stube_hinten_links<CR>','LEQ0250425,Bewaesserung<CR>','LEQ0397071,Wandtaster_Treppe_DG<CR>','LEQ0397107,Funkwandtaster_02<CR>','LEQ0397120,Funkwandtaster_03<CR>','LEQ0417179,Klima_Studio<CR>','LEQ0440620,Klima_Bureau<CR>','LEQ0629532,Griff_Studio_links<CR>','LEQ0631051,Griff_Kueche<CR>','LEQ0773306,Pooltemperaturen<CR>','LEQ0773307,FBH_EG_Ruecklauf_01<CR>','LEQ0889352,Griff Gast<CR>','LEQ1236782,Klingeltaster<CR>','LTK0044647,Wandtaster_Werkstatt<CR>','LTK0045860,Taster Küche hinten<CR>','LTK0124143,Hamsterkaefig<CR>','LTK0124191.....
                            

                            kann mich aber nicht erinnern irgendwo etwas umgestellt zu haben
                            Doch habe ich - sorry habe aus der Liste keinen Text mehr erstellt

                            paul53 1 Reply Last reply Reply Quote -1
                            • paul53
                              paul53 @Homoran last edited by

                              @Homoran sagte:

                              HM-LC-Sw1_PBU nehmen könnte.

                              Diese Information hat ioBroker nicht, es sein denn Du hast sie bewusst irgendwo mit untergebracht.

                              1 Reply Last reply Reply Quote 0
                              • Homoran
                                Homoran Global Moderator Administrators last edited by

                                @paul53

                                Lass gut sein, das wird zu aufwändig!

                                Ich habe es mir gerade noch einmal angesehen, die Räume, die auf der CCU vergeben wurden sind zum einen nur ab Kanal:1, also weder beim Gerät, noch bei dem Kanal mit unreach, zum anderen kommen diese ja über den hm-rega, den du nicht verwendest.

                                Den Gerätetyp habe ich unter native, TYPE ebenfalls nur im RAW des Geräts gefunden, nicht in Kanal 0

                                {
                                  "_id": "hm-rpc.0.KEQ0543528",
                                  "type": "device",
                                  "common": {
                                    "name": "Heizkreis",
                                    "icon": "/icons/IP65_G201_thumb.png"
                                  },
                                  "native": {
                                    "ADDRESS": "KEQ0543528",
                                    "CHILDREN": [
                                      "KEQ0543528:0",
                                      "KEQ0543528:1",
                                      "KEQ0543528:2",
                                      "KEQ0543528:3",
                                      "KEQ0543528:4",
                                      "KEQ0543528:5"
                                    ],
                                    "FIRMWARE": "1.1",
                                    "FLAGS": 1,
                                    "INTERFACE": "KEQ1065589",
                                    "PARAMSETS": [
                                      "MASTER"
                                    ],
                                    "PARENT": "",
                                    "RF_ADDRESS": 2224197,
                                    "ROAMING": 1,
                                    "RX_MODE": 12,
                                    "TYPE": "HM-WDS30-OT2-SM",
                                    "UPDATABLE": 1,
                                    "VERSION": 5
                                  },
                                  "from": "system.adapter.hm-rega.0",
                                  "user": "system.user.admin",
                                  "ts": 1599044955264,
                                  "acl": {
                                    "object": 1636,
                                    "owner": "system.user.admin",
                                    "ownerGroup": "system.group.administrator"
                                  }
                                }
                                
                                paul53 1 Reply Last reply Reply Quote 0
                                • paul53
                                  paul53 @Homoran last edited by

                                  @Homoran sagte:

                                  Den Gerätetyp habe ich unter native, TYPE ebenfalls nur im RAW des Geräts gefunden

                                  Du hast recht. Den kann man abfragen. Funktion deviceType(id):

                                  id = id.substring(0, id.lastIndexOf('.'));
                                  id = id.substring(0, id.lastIndexOf('.'));
                                  if(existsObject(id) && getObject(id).type == 'device') return getObject(id).native.TYPE;
                                  
                                  Homoran 1 Reply Last reply Reply Quote 1
                                  • Homoran
                                    Homoran Global Moderator Administrators @paul53 last edited by

                                    @paul53 sagte in Liste der Homematic Geräte erstellen:

                                    Den kann man abfragen

                                    Danke mal wieder!!

                                    HM_Liste_Tabelle_V2.png

                                    Dann will ich mal an die Arbeit 😉

                                    1 Reply Last reply Reply Quote 0
                                    • FredF
                                      FredF Most Active Forum Testing last edited by

                                      @Homoran @paul53
                                      Danke für diesen Beitrag, habe mir damit eine Liste der zigbee Geräte erstellt.

                                      paul53 1 Reply Last reply Reply Quote 0
                                      • paul53
                                        paul53 @FredF last edited by

                                        @FredF sagte:

                                        habe mir damit eine Liste der zigbee Geräte erstellt.

                                        Sicherlich nicht mit "0.UNREACH".

                                        FredF 1 Reply Last reply Reply Quote 1
                                        • FredF
                                          FredF Most Active Forum Testing @paul53 last edited by

                                          @paul53 Klar, nein. Mit

                                          zigbee.0.*.available
                                          
                                          1 Reply Last reply Reply Quote 0
                                          • Peoples
                                            Peoples last edited by Peoples

                                            @Homoran
                                            Ich frage nur aus Neugier, warum willst du das im Iobroker machen? Im Homematic Forum gab es da doch mal so ein Inventur - Script.

                                            Das folgende Ausgabe bringt (hier als Auszug):

                                            .
                                            .
                                            ...
                                             115 NEQ093XXXX HM-TC-IT-WM-W-EU (Wandthermostat.Wohnz)
                                                           :1 Wandthermostat.Wohnz.NEQ093XXXX:1
                                                           :2 Wandthermostat.Wohnz.NEQ093XXXX:2
                                                           :3 Wandthermostat.Wohnz.NEQ093XXXX:3
                                                           :6 Wandthermostat.Wohnz.NEQ093XXXX:6
                                                           :7 Wandthermostat.Wohnz.NEQ093XXXX:7
                                            116 OEQ036XXXX HM-WDS100-C6-O-2 (Wetterstation)
                                                           :1 Wetterstation.OEQ036XXXX:1
                                             117 INT0000001 HM-CC-VG-1 (Wohnen | Heizen  INT0000001)
                                                           :1 Wohnen | Heizen  INT0000001:1
                                                           :2 Wohnen | Heizen  INT0000001:2
                                            --------------------------------------------
                                            356 Kanäle in 117 Geräten:
                                            1x HM-PB-6-WM55, 8x HM-CC-VG-1, 1x HM-Sen-MDIR-O, 7x HM-Sen-MDIR-WM55, 1x HM-Sen-MDIR-O-3, 31x HM-Sec-SCo, 1x HM-Sec-RHS, 1x HM-MOD-Re-8, 1x HM-RC-Key4-3, 1x HM-RC-Sec4-3, 1x HmIP-RCV-50, 5x HM-LC-Bl1PBU-FM, 2x HM-LC-Sw1-DR, 11x HM-LC-Sw1-FM, 4x HM-LC-Sw2PBU-FM, 4x HM-LC-Dim1T-FM, 1x HM-LC-Dim1T-Pl-3, 1x HM-Sen-LI-O, 2x HM-LC-Sw4-DR, 1x HM-Sec-TiS, 3x HM-ES-PMSw1-DR, 1x HM-LC-Sw1-Ba-PCB, 1x HM-Sec-Sir-WM, 2x HM-ES-PMSw1-Pl, 1x HM-WDS30-OT2-SM, 15x HM-CC-RT-DN, 1x HM-MOD-EM-8, 7x HM-TC-IT-WM-W-EU, 1x HM-WDS100-C6-O-2
                                            --------------------------------------------
                                            
                                            
                                            Homoran 1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            1.1k
                                            Online

                                            31.7k
                                            Users

                                            79.7k
                                            Topics

                                            1.3m
                                            Posts

                                            5
                                            37
                                            2476
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o